"Raymonda" at the War Memorial Opera House
Through March 8 | Civic Center/UN Plaza
Times Vary | 301 Van Ness Ave.
San Francisco Ballet's "Raymonda" is a reimagined classic tale set against the backdrop of the 19th-century Crimean War. Directed and choreographed by Tamara Roja, you'll follow Raymonda, a courageous woman ahead of her time, and hear Alexander Glazunov's soaring score performed by the Grammy Award-winning SF Ballet Orchestra. Catch the show 0.3 miles from Civic Center/UN Plaza.
"Back to the Future – The Musical"
Through March 9 | Civic Center/UN Plaza
Times Vary | 1192 Market Street
"Back to the Future: The Musical," winner of multiple awards, including the 2022 Olivier Award for Best New Musical, has arrived in San Francisco. The iconic story follows Marty McFly as he travels back to 1955 and must race against time to restore the present and return to the future. Catch the cinematic classic turned Broadway musical at Orpheum Theatre just steps from Civic Center/UN Plaza.

“Ain’t Too Proud – The Life and Times of the Temptations"
Through March 2 | Civic Center/UN Plaza
Times Vary | 1 Taylor St.
BroadwaySF presents the fascinating story of The Temptations from their early days in Detroit to becoming one of the greatest R&B bands of all time. The Tony award-winning performance features classic hits like “My Girl” and “Papa Was a Rolling Stone.” See the show at the Golden Gate Theatre, just 0.2 miles from Civic Center/UN Plaza.
